WebThe area of a circle is: π ( Pi) times the Radius squared: A = π r2 or, when you know the Diameter: A = (π/4) × D2 or, when you know the Circumference: A = C2 / 4π Example: What is the area of a circle with radius of 3 m ? Radius = r = 3 Area = π r2 = π × 32 = 3.14159... × (3 × 3) = 28.27 m2 (to 2 decimal places) How to Remember? birthday gifts for 19 year old daughter https://mikebolton.net

WebFirst you need to know that the equation for a circle is (x-a)^2 + (y-b)^2 = r^2 where the center is at point (a,b) and the radius is r. so for instance (x-2)^2 + (y-3)^2 = 4 would have the center at (2,3) and have a radius of 2 since 4 = 2^2. This means if you went a distance of 2 away from that center point you would be on the circle. WebHow to calculate square feet For a square or rectangular shaped room or area, measure the length and width of the area in feet. Then, multiply the length and width figures together. As an example, if your room measures 14 feet wide by 18 feet long, your calculation is 14 × 18 = 252 square feet. Websquare the ˈcircle (try to) do something that is or seems impossible: The Government is trying to square the circle when it says it will spend more on the health service without … WebFirst, find the equation for the circle. Like this, x^2 + (y - 3)^2 = 9. Then, input the x and y values into the equation. If it's bigger than 9, the point is outside of the circle, if it's equal to 9, the point is on the circle, and if it's smaller than 9, the point is inside of the circle.
